How to migrate to Hong Kong

How to migrate to Hong Kong

If you have your visa approved, and you have made your mind up to move – at least in the short term – you may well be wondering now how to migrate to Hong Kong.

Depending on how long you plan on staying, the packing will either need to be comprehensive or just sufficient to get you through in reasonable comfort until it's time to return home.

Migrate to Hong Kong :


In the midst of all your questions about how to migrate to Hong Kong, you may be wondering how difficult it will be to settle down. Although Hong Kong is an Asian country it has had so many western influences, especially with British rule until 1997. This means it offers a unique fusion of east meets west, truly the best of both worlds!

Some items such as furniture can be purchased ridiculously cheaply in Hong Kong, with custom-made models available widely for a very economical price. The price of replacing all your furniture with new models is likely to be far cheaper – and less hassle too! - than the price of shipping everything out. If you were wondering how to migrate to Hong Kong, not having to worry about your furniture can be a major relief

Hong Kong Immigration Requirements :


Not everything is as cheap in Hong Kong and it's a good idea to acquaint yourself with what the potential costs will be before you arrive, to prevent a nasty shock. Because Hong Kong is so densely populated, accommodation is in high demand and consequently the price is sky high even for relatively modest premises. You will have to consider if you want to live in an ex-pat community or mingle more freely with the locals. Bear in mind that traditional Hong Kong apartments and dwellings will not have an oven, so you might find it easier to opt for a more western design.

Before migrating to Hong Kong, if you can negotiate a remuneration package which includes accommodation you might find this preferable than being tied into a contract and handing over the cash to your landlord directly.

Despite some extremely high living costs, gross salaries are not particularly high in Hong Kong. But this is compensated for because taxation in Hong Kong is very low, one of the more significant attractions! And the excellent news is that with many other Asian countries vying for the best of the market, there is an almost unparalleled number of jobs available for overseas workers.
